Everything on this site traces back to public records. This page lists exactly where each piece comes from, links the original sources, and lets you download the compiled dataset. The underlying government records are already public; this project's job is to join them together and make them readable.
Data on this site is a one-time snapshot, not a live feed. It was scraped on 30 June 2026 and covers contracts published 21 August 2023 – 1 April 2026. It is not updated as new contracts are awarded.
Where the data comes from
Contract records — Karnataka Public Procurement Portal (KPPP). The awarded road, drain, and asphalting works, as filed by BBMP. There is no public human-viewable per-tender page on KPPP to link to directly, but any contract on this site can be looked up by its tender number — free, captcha, no account — so the tender ID and number are the traceable key. The underlying data is served by KPPP's public, machine-readable API, which is how it was obtained.

Ward boundaries and the locality-to-ward schedule — BBMP, via
OpenCity (public domain). Both come from BBMP's 2023 final 225-ward
delimitation. The ward-boundary map (BBMP_225.geojson) is
converted from OpenCity's 225-ward KML; the area-to-ward lookup is parsed
from BBMP's final delimitation notification of 25 September 2023
(final_circular.pdf). Both files come from the same OpenCity
dataset page below.

Ward-to-corporation mapping — BBMP wards over the GBA's 5
corporations, via OpenCity (public domain). Each ward card names
the City Corporation the ward now falls under. That mapping is computed by
overlaying the 225 BBMP wards on the Greater Bengaluru Authority's
five-corporation boundaries — the September 2025 final
corporations map (GBA_5corps_sept2025.kml), not the earlier
July draft.

Also consulted — BBMP draft delimitation gazette, 18 August
2023 (gazette_notification.pdf). An earlier draft,
superseded by the 25 September 2023 final notification above. Used only as a
cross-check while parsing the locality schedule; it is the source of no
figure on this site.

The compiled dataset joins the KPPP contract records to wards and deduplicates them — the ward-joined, readable form you can't get from the raw sources. It is released into the public domain. A README documents every field, the row counts, and the known gaps; read it before drawing conclusions.
- dataset.csv — one row per ward-placement
- dataset.json — the same data, keyed by ward, structure preserved
- dataset_README.md — field documentation, counts, and caveats

Absence of a road or contract from this site means it was outside our scope or scrape window — not that no work happened.
Licence and reuse
The compiled dataset and this site's content are released into the public domain — no permission or attribution needed, though a link back helps others find the originals. The source records are public by origin: the contract data is authored by the government via KPPP; the ward geometry and locality schedule are authored by BBMP and obtained via OpenCity (public domain).
